They may have went one step back, but there is many steps forward that make me reconsider the 1020 and make me want to get 1520.

The fact that there is a better processor, better screen, unified camera app, and MicroSD support over the 1020 make it a very tempting choice, the only thing that makes me want to get the 1020 is the camera and screen size as 6 inches is too big for me.

As has already been noted more than once, Gorilla glass is not going to add much in case of a fall. It is about scratch resistance and general durability. As many owners of every Gorilla glass screen on the market can attest, drop the device and the screen can break. Quite frankly, just adding another digit foes not mean a better product for the intended use. It simply means newer and in some cases even that is not true.
